Job description

JOB SUMMARYThe Lifeguard is responsible for the safety of patrons in the pool(s) and surrounding environments. Act as first responder in emergency situations. Provide customer service to all members, participants and guests. Follow and enforce all City of Conroe and Center policies and procedures. Participate in all in-service training sessions. Conduct various pool maintenance duties, including testing water chemistry and checking mechanical system operation. Complete all required records and reports.QUALIFICATIONSEducation and Experience:Minimum age of 15. Must be pursuing high school diploma or equivalent. Must possess current American Red Cross Certifications in Lifeguarding and CPR for the Professional Rescuer. Knowledge, Skills and Abilities: Knowledge of and up to date on all required certifications. Skill in good communication and public relation skills. Ability to walk, stand, kneel, climb, sit and swim for long periods of time. Ability to lift 75 lbs.Ability to demonstrate leadership. PHYSICAL DEMANDSThe work requires medium and requires the ability to exert up to 50 pounds of force occasionally, and/or up to 30 pounds of force frequently, and/or up to 10 pounds of force constantly to move objects. Additionally, the following physical abilities are required: balancing, climbing, crouching, feeling, grasping, handling, hearing, kneeling, lifting, mental acuity, pulling, reaching, repetitive motions, speaking, standing, talking and walking.BENEFITSThe City of Conroe offers an employee assistance program and free membership at the City's pool and recreation center facilities for all employees. Starting salary for this position is $10.697 hourly.The City of Conroe is an Equal Opportunity EmployerMust pass background check and pre-employment substance abuse screening as a condition of employment. A motor vehicle record check and job-related doctor's physical exam may also be required. Safety-sensitive positions remain subject to random drug and alcohol testing after hire.
